Truth Social outshines faltering right-wing competitors in social media arena.

Donald Trump’s venture into the realm of social media has demonstrated remarkable growth, surpassing platforms like Parler and Gettr in conservative circles. However, despite this progress, Trump’s platform still trails significantly behind major players in the social media landscape such as X and other dominant platforms.
